Emotional debut for Badosa

“Rematch next year?”, “Where do you have to sign?” Said and done. The friendly exchange of messages that were dedicated Victoria Azarenka (27th) and Paula Badosa (8th) on Twitter after concluding the Indian Wells finale, will come true today in the Adelaide WTA 500, first tournament of the women’s circuit where the Belarusian and the Spanish will close the second day of competition (DAZN, not before 10:30) with a match that promises strong emotions. The only duel between the two took place in that game for the title in the Californian desert in which The Catalan was crowned with her first WTA 1,000 trophy After three hours of hard battle, a meeting is expected, and more so at the beginning of the course, one of the most even.

Beyond the healthy sporting rivalry, Badosa and Azarenka have a fantastic relationship. After knowing the Whimsical draw that matched them in the first round, the Catalan confessed that they were training together: “After the draw we thought, ‘What do we do?’ It’s okay for us, we can train. I learn from you and she learns from me. So that’s what we did.”

And there is nothing left, because the Belarusian and the Spanish have already added hours on the track in 2022 … as partners. Last monday, Azarenka and Badosa started their way into the doubles draw with a solid triumph over the top seeds, the Japanese Aoyama and Shibahara (6-4 and 6-2). Undoubtedly, a good sign for both of them to move the show, individually, to one and the other side of the network …
